sourisdudesert wrote:Just a word to say that we know this is an issue.
Good to know... but....
One of the possible future could be :
- Special interface for those who only want to play with friends (no need to pollute the lobby with private games).
- Propose an "Automatic mode" for those who just want to play asap with games/opponents that meet their (custom) criteria.
- Keep the current lobby for those who want to precisely choose what & against who to play.
I'm not sure if I'm understanding what this means. Or more specifically, what "automatic mode" is supposed to mean, especially after you mentioned that a huge number of people never create invites and this would solve that. I'm one of them - I rarely create invites. I'm not sure if you're meaning I'd automatically be joined to a game, or if it would create an invite for me, or what. I wouldn't want to do anything like that. I want to be able to keep all known games in my list so I see those invites up top, and then scroll the list to find what I want to play. I can't say that I'm looking for something in particular and therefore want to use that criteria. I'd rather see what is available and decide for myself, and things like a criteria for a player isn't that simple. (I want to LOOK at that player, not just go by numbers that have a meaning to you but maybe not to me.) Honestly, this sounds a little more "real time" geared, someone who wants to play some specific game right now. I'm doing turn-based and may be taking several games, and based on what looks good at the time, and not based on a decision I made ahead of time.
But based on this set of options, that puts me in the 3rd category, which is how it is now that a lot of us are having issues with. It doesn't really solve the issue if the only other option is automatic.
I agree a filter is a much better idea, so that I can still scroll through the list on my own and make my own decisions.
Right before I hopped on the forums, I counted the turn-based invitation list, and made note of how many games I actually qualify for. I couldn't play
85% of the games - not even close to 30%. This includes both games I simply didn't quality for, but also games that were full and waiting on people to start, because I can't play those either. So I could play 15% of that mess, and was only interested in 1 invite. Some of the reasons I didn't take certain games would require pretty complex criteria, some of it subjective. But, if only that 15% were in the list, it would be a whole lot easier to look through.
I just want the other 85% to go away, not have it do anything automatically for me.
